I grow, in the corner of a 13x9 ft room, a few plants. I want to know if I could use a carbon filter anywhere in the room to clean the air of odors? I want to put an intake near the plants, wich goes thru a Carb.filter and the outtake on the other side of the room... The filter will filter the same air again and again... Will this lower the odors in the room? I can't blow the air out of the room... This is my problem...

The deal with carbon filters is you have to maintain a negative prssure to prevent odor leaks. That means you'd have to partition off a section of space (like a tent) to keep it fresh. Just recirculating in a room isn't going to cut it. If you can't be venting like that, I'd recommend you look into a programmable/periodic misting system like a Vaportronic. It's not going to work. I tried it. I had my door open just a crack and the odor leaked out really bad. I thought my carbon filter was spent, but I did it properly and now the odor is eliminated. It is amazing how well carbon filters work.

Outside my grow room I can't smell it at all...inside, smells like a skunk pissed in your face, and I'm not quite 3 weeks into flowering yet.

If you think it smells now and you're in veg, you've got another thing coming.

You would be best to buy a tent for your grow room, inside the room.
